Vasseur’s Recipe For Success

Jean-Luc Vasseur believes he has all the ingredients he needs to make Everton Women a success as he seeks his first win in the Barclays FA Women’s Super League this weekend.

The Blues travel to face Leicester City on Sunday, the side that Vasseur guided his team to a 3-1 Continental Cup win against in his first game in charge.

Now, after having a number of weeks to work with his players, the Frenchman is convinced he has the raw materials at his disposal to produce the positive results.

You can imagine that I’m in my kitchen and there’s a lot of ingredients in front of me,” Vasseur explained in his press conference.

“We need to find the right recipe to bring it all together every weekend.

“When there’s a lot of talent in the squad it is nice, but we need to look at the details to find a team that is balanced and efficient.

“At this moment, I am happy because I have this recipe and I don’t need to go buy other ingredients.

“Perhaps in the future [I will buy more] but for now I need to cook with these ingredients and find the right recipe.”

Everton picked up their first-ever WSL point against Manchester United last weekend - and Vasseur’s first in the English top-flight.

He praised his side’s resilience to come from behind and produce a great performance and now hopes his players can build on their momentum when they take on the Foxes.

“It was important for us to break the negative momentum against the Manchester clubs,” he said.

“We had a run of defeats against these sides in the league so it was good to get a point and we finished the game better.

“It was good for the confidence for my team.

“There is a resilience about this team.

Leicester are yet to pick up points this season since their promotion from the Championship, losing all of their opening seven league matches.

But Vasseur knows that the Championship champions will be desperate to get off the mark and stressed there will be no complacency within the Everton camp.

“It is never right to see a game as easy, to not respect the opponent," he added.

“Never have this state of mind.

“You can get yourself into a dangerous situation if you think like this.

“We give the opponent a lot of respect and find a good way to reveal the weakness of their team but never to play easy.

“They are suffering from some bad momentum at the moment, and they will want to put a stop to that.

“However, I don’t want that to happen against Everton so we go there on Sunday with a lot of respect and preparation.

“We go there to win but I know it will be difficult.

“Even though we won there a few weeks ago, we need to stay vigilant.

“We have to be focused and determined.

“We have the talent to win again but every player must be focused on the plan to complete the mission.”
